The Basic Steps of Two Way Slab Design
When the ratio of the long span to short span is less than 2, the slab is known as a slab spanning in two directions (two way slab). Â The basic steps of two way slab design are:
Choose layout and type of slab. (Type of slab is strongly affected by architectural and construction considerations).
Choose slab thickness to control deflection. Also, check if thickness is adequate for shear.
Choose design method. (Equivalent frame method – use elastic frame analysis to compute positive and negative moments or Direct design method – uses coeficients to compute positive and negative slab moments) Calculate positive and negative moments in the slab
Determine distribution of moments across the width of the slab (based on geometry and beam stiffness).
Assign a portion of moment to beams, if present
Design reinforcement for moments from step 5 and 6. The steps 3-7 need to be done for both principal directions.
Check shear strengths at the columns.
